Elements and Performance Criteria
- Maintain operation of reel system (OR Element 2 OR Element 3)
- Reel stand and rewind section is monitored and adjusted to maintain correct tension and to ensure no marks, blemishes or damage to finished product and to ensure efficient continuous operation
- Web control system is monitored and adjusted to ensure correct tension and accurate continuous positioning of the web and efficient operation
- Substrate is added to and removed from process according to job instructions
- Sheeting section is monitored and adjusted to ensure quality and efficient product delivery
- Set-off/marking prevention system is monitored and adjusted to ensure quality of printed product without set-off or marking meets the standard of approved proof
- Maintain operation of sheet system (OR Element 1 OR Element 3)
- Feeder and delivery is monitored and adjusted to ensure continuous and efficient feeding to machine
- Sheet pick-up and transport system is monitored and adjusted to ensure accurate and continuous sheet handling and efficient operation
- Transfer systems are monitored and adjusted to ensure correct and continuous sheet handling and efficient operation
- Substrate is added to and removed from process according to job instructions
- Set-off/marking prevention system is monitored and adjusted to ensure quality of printed product without set-off or marking meets the standard of approved proof
- Maintain in-line loading and ejection (OR Element 4 OR Element 5)
- Maintain production process
- Production process is operated in association with fellow workers and according to company specifications and planned daily schedule
- If necessary, the location of objects into fixtures/jigs is monitored and adjusted
- Foil transfer system is monitored and adjusted to ensure quality of printed product meets the standard of approved proof
- Basic in-line printing/converting/binding/finishing process(es) are monitored and adjusted to ensure quality of product meets the standard of the approved proof
- Production is maintained within OHS requirements and company and manufacturer's specifications
- Manual and/or automatic control is used as per specification
- Performance is monitored and verified using the process control system according to enterprise procedures
- Foil performance and position of print are monitored and adjusted throughout production run
- Waste is sorted according to enterprise procedures
- Identify and rectify problems
- Production difficulties are anticipated and preventive action is taken to prevent occurrence by timely intervention
- Process adjustments to eliminate problems are reported according to enterprise procedures
- Faulty performance of equipment is identified and reported according to enterprise procedures
- Problem in foil stamping machine operation is identified and reported according to enterprise procedures
- Adjustments or corrections are carried out according to specified procedures and consistent with operator's skill level
- Foil stamping machine operation is checked to ensure correct operation
- Conduct shutdown of production process
- Correct shutdown sequence is followed according to manufacturer's specifications and enterprise procedures
- Shutdown is conducted in association with fellow workers and in compliance with OHS requirements
- Unused foil is correctly labelled and stored according to manufacturer/supplier specifications and enterprise procedures
- Waste is removed from operating area and recycled or disposed of, where required, according to regulatory requirements and enterprise procedures
- All product is removed from operating area
- Machine faults requiring repair are identified and reported to designated person according to enterprise procedures
- Repair/adjustment is verified prior to resumption of operations
- Clean printing machine at end of print run
- In-line printing/converting/binding/finishing units are cleaned ready for next run
- Reel feed, transportation and delivery systems are disengaged and cleaned ready for next run OR
- Sheet feed, transport and delivery systems are disengaged and cleaned ready for next run OR
- Jig and conveyors are disengaged and cleaned ready for next run
- Production records or other documentation are accurately completed where required by enterprise procedures
